MBDA completes initial Marte ER test flight
Luca Peruzzi, Genoa - Jane's Missiles & Rockets
28 November 2018
MBDA has successfully completed the first test flight of a prototype Marte ER anti-ship missile.
“The Marte ER missile flew for more than 100 km on a planned trajectory that included several waypoints and sea skimming flight, successfully testing all flying phases,” MBDA said in a press statement.
The ground-launched test was conducted on 9 November at an unspecified Italian test range, which Jane’s has identified as the Joint Armed Forces test range at Salto Di Quirra in Sardinia. Jane's understands that the missile canister was installed at an ashore coastal test facility, with the flight conducted over the Salto Di Quirra test range area at sea to achieve the missile’s intended range.
